Post-Operative Treatment Directions



Following your cataract surgical procedure, it's critical to follow the post-operative treatment guidelines offered by your ophthalmologist. These directions are created to advertise recovery and ensure the very best possible outcome. Your optometrist may recommend using prescribed eye drops to prevent infection and reduce inflammation. It's essential to follow the recommended dose and regularity meticulously.

Throughout the preliminary recuperation period, you should prevent arduous tasks, heavy lifting, and bending over. It's important to secure your eyes from irritants and direct sunshine by putting on sunglasses. Your physician may encourage you to use an eye shield while sleeping to stop unexpected massaging or stress on the eye.

Go to all follow-up visits as set up to monitor your healing progression and attend to any problems promptly. If you experience abrupt vision changes, extreme discomfort, or indicators of infection, contact your ophthalmologist promptly.
